Serra da Estrela Natural Park
Serra da Estrela is the star of the show (literally!). This stunning natural park boasts Portugal's highest peak, offering incredible hiking trails, breathtaking views, and opportunities for wildlife spotting. Pack your boots and get ready for some serious exploring!
Seia's Historic Centre
Wander through the charming streets of Seia's historic centre, admiring the traditional architecture and soaking up the atmosphere. You'll find plenty of quaint shops, cafes, and restaurants to explore.
Loriga
The village of Loriga, perched high in the mountains, offers stunning panoramic views and a glimpse into traditional Portuguese village life. It's a perfect spot for a relaxing afternoon.
Covão do Meio
Covão do Meio is a glacial lake nestled within Serra da Estrela, a truly picturesque spot for a picnic or a peaceful stroll. The views are simply unforgettable.

When’s the Best Time to Go?
Summer (June-August) offers warm weather perfect for hiking and outdoor activities. Spring (April-May) and autumn (September-October) provide pleasant temperatures and fewer crowds. Winter (November-March) can be cold and snowy, ideal for skiing and snowboarding at Serra da Estrela.
